In January, Sapa generally has pleasant temperatures and high rainfall. January is a winter month. Anticipate daytime temperatures around 19°C, while night temperatures can drop to 10°C. On average, it is the month with the lowest temperatures of the year. However the temperature is still pleasant and it won't ever get really cold.

Sapa in January usually receives high rainfall, averaging around 105 mm for the month. Based on our climate data of the past 30 years, about 8 days of rain are anticipated.

The area experiences a moderate amount of sunshine, with approximately 113 hours of sunlight expected. This makes it neither too gloomy nor overly bright.

Sapa, monthly averages in January

Min TemperatureMin Temperature 10°C  
Max TemperatureMax Temperature 19°C  
Chance of RainChance of Rain 27%  
PrecipitationPrecipitation 105 mm  
Rainy daysRainy days 8 days  
HumidityHumidity 86%  
SunshineSunshine 113 hours  
Percentage SunshinePercentage Sunshine 34%
